1. Suppose that S is a positively-oriented (or outward-oriented) closed cylinder of radius R and finite height h. (a) Determine div F, where F = (xy, y + z, x - yz). (b) Use the Divergence Theorem to compute the flux of F across S (Hint: you should not need to actually compute a triple integral here - instead, think about what it represents).
